реклама на сайте
подробности

 
 
4 страниц V   1 2 3 > »   
Reply to this topicStart new topic
> Часы, Поиск задающего генератора
Anjey_N
сообщение Oct 14 2007, 14:34
Сообщение #1


Частый гость
**

Группа: Участник
Сообщений: 80
Регистрация: 12-01-07
Из: Энергодар Украина
Пользователь №: 24 374



Привет!
Хочу сделать простые часы на базе Attiny 2313 с внешним задающим генератором.
Что посоветуете в качестве задающего генератора?
Go to the top of the page
 
+Quote Post
VDLab
сообщение Oct 14 2007, 15:56
Сообщение #2


Частый гость
**

Группа: Свой
Сообщений: 133
Регистрация: 30-04-07
Из: DP.UA
Пользователь №: 27 419



Ну попробуй цезиевый генератор поставить... smile.gif

А чем свой генератор не устраивает? Тем более для ПРОСТЫХ часов.
Go to the top of the page
 
+Quote Post
Anjey_N
сообщение Oct 14 2007, 18:32
Сообщение #3


Частый гость
**

Группа: Участник
Сообщений: 80
Регистрация: 12-01-07
Из: Энергодар Украина
Пользователь №: 24 374



Цитата(VDLab @ Oct 14 2007, 18:56) *
Ну попробуй цезиевый генератор поставить... smile.gif

А чем свой генератор не устраивает? Тем более для ПРОСТЫХ часов.


Делал как-то 2 года назад часы на PIC16F84. Работают до сих пор, но отстают на минуту за несколько суток.
Вообщето есть сломаные часы "СТАРТ" (конструктор). Хочу поставить АЛС и микроконтроллер. Подумал, что с внешним генератором будут работать точнее.

Может, что-нибудь посоветуете?
Go to the top of the page
 
+Quote Post
DS
сообщение Oct 14 2007, 18:44
Сообщение #4


Гуру
******

Группа: СуперМодераторы
Сообщений: 3 096
Регистрация: 16-01-06
Из: Москва
Пользователь №: 13 250



Поставьте внешний RTC чип. Если нужна точность, можно DS3231. Или другой какой. Я не думаю, что тспользование генератора вместо RTC что-нибудь заметно сэкономит.


--------------------
Не бойтесь тюрьмы, не бойтесь сумы, не бойтесь мора и глада, а бойтесь единственно только того, кто скажет - "Я знаю как надо". А. Галич.
Go to the top of the page
 
+Quote Post
bzx
сообщение Oct 14 2007, 20:35
Сообщение #5


Местный
***

Группа: Свой
Сообщений: 482
Регистрация: 5-07-05
Из: Санкт-Петербург
Пользователь №: 6 528



Цитата(Anjey_N @ Oct 14 2007, 22:32) *
Делал как-то 2 года назад часы на PIC16F84. Работают до сих пор, но отстают на минуту за несколько суток.
...
Может, что-нибудь посоветуете?

Программную коррекцию хода часов сделай.


--------------------
Для связи email: info собака qbit.su
Go to the top of the page
 
+Quote Post
=GM=
сообщение Oct 14 2007, 21:02
Сообщение #6


Ambidexter
*****

Группа: Свой
Сообщений: 1 589
Регистрация: 22-06-06
Из: Oxford, UK
Пользователь №: 18 282



Цитата(Anjey_N @ Oct 14 2007, 14:34) *
Хочу сделать простые часы на базе Attiny 2313 с внешним задающим генератором. Что посоветуете в качестве задающего генератора?

Что, если принимать какую-нибудь круглосуточную радиостанцию в диапазоне ДВ или СВ и по сигналам точного времени (в конце каждого часа) проводить коррекцию? Приемник можно сделать прямого усиления, схем в Сети полно.


--------------------
Делай сразу хорошо, плохо само получится
Go to the top of the page
 
+Quote Post
add
сообщение Oct 15 2007, 06:25
Сообщение #7


Местный
***

Группа: Свой
Сообщений: 345
Регистрация: 10-10-05
Пользователь №: 9 459



Цитата(=GM= @ Oct 15 2007, 01:02) *
Что, если принимать какую-нибудь круглосуточную радиостанцию в диапазоне ДВ или СВ и по сигналам точного времени (в конце каждого часа) проводить коррекцию? Приемник можно сделать прямого усиления, схем в Сети полно.

хм.. а не проще, а главное точнее, присобачить GPS приемник? В НМЕА протоколе есть времечко. Вот только цена устроит ли вопрошающего?


--------------------
Если задачу можно решить, то не надо тревожиться. А если нельзя решить, то тревожиться бесполезно.
Go to the top of the page
 
+Quote Post
mse
сообщение Oct 15 2007, 07:02
Сообщение #8


Знающий
****

Группа: Свой
Сообщений: 709
Регистрация: 3-05-05
Пользователь №: 4 693



Цитата(add @ Oct 15 2007, 10:25) *
хм.. а не проще, а главное точнее, присобачить GPS приемник? В НМЕА протоколе есть времечко. Вот только цена устроит ли вопрошающего?

Гы...Тогда проще, а, главное, несравненно дешевле, тупо купить кетайские чясы. ;О) С УКВ приёмником, термометром и кофем в постель.
Go to the top of the page
 
+Quote Post
Anjey_N
сообщение Oct 15 2007, 07:28
Сообщение #9


Частый гость
**

Группа: Участник
Сообщений: 80
Регистрация: 12-01-07
Из: Энергодар Украина
Пользователь №: 24 374



С кофе в постель было бы неплохо!
Можно поставить RTC, но у Атину2313 нет аппаратного I2C. Писать программный интерфейс неохота.
Сделаю наверно проще буду использовать в качестве задающей системную частоту МК (В PICe я применял кварц на 4096 кГц, попробую и сейчас такой). А корректировку попробую сделать как в наручных часах "Электроника" производства Беларусь.

У меня есть книга Шпака "Программирование на Си микроконтроллеров АВР и ПИК". Там есть проект "Часы иеального времени", в котором применяется МК ATmega169. В качестве калибратора применяется микросхема E1217X от Атмел. В ATmega169 есть спецрегистры для калибровки внутреннего генератора.


Вообщем не знаю как и поступить!?
Go to the top of the page
 
+Quote Post
Seasonf
сообщение Oct 15 2007, 07:48
Сообщение #10





Группа: Новичок
Сообщений: 10
Регистрация: 7-08-06
Пользователь №: 19 378



Часы дают здесь:
http://www.radiokot.ru/circuit/digital/home/09/

подрихтовать на предмет точности и не надо велосипед изобретать....
Go to the top of the page
 
+Quote Post
defunct
сообщение Oct 15 2007, 10:25
Сообщение #11


кекс
******

Группа: Свой
Сообщений: 3 825
Регистрация: 17-12-05
Из: Киев
Пользователь №: 12 326



Цитата(add @ Oct 15 2007, 09:25) *
хм.. а не проще, а главное точнее, присобачить GPS приемник? В НМЕА протоколе есть времечко. Вот только цена устроит ли вопрошающего?

Для ПРОСТЫХ часов самое лучшее решение smile.gif Самое простое и самое дешевое smile.gif

Цитата(Anjey_N @ Oct 15 2007, 10:28) *
Вообщем не знаю как и поступить!?

Мегу48 и часовой кварц + программная коррекция и синхронизация с часами компа по 232.
Go to the top of the page
 
+Quote Post
muravei
сообщение Oct 15 2007, 10:28
Сообщение #12


Гуру
******

Группа: Свой
Сообщений: 2 538
Регистрация: 13-08-05
Пользователь №: 7 591



Цитата(defunct @ Oct 15 2007, 14:20) *
Для ПРОСТЫХ часов самое лучшее решение

Конечно, такие часы смогут ответить не только на вопрос когда, но и где?
Иногда , по утру, это актуально smile.gif
А вообще, есть станции , вещающие частоту специально для привязки времени.
Go to the top of the page
 
+Quote Post
add
сообщение Oct 15 2007, 10:34
Сообщение #13


Местный
***

Группа: Свой
Сообщений: 345
Регистрация: 10-10-05
Пользователь №: 9 459



Цитата(defunct @ Oct 15 2007, 14:20) *
Для ПРОСТЫХ часов самое лучшее решение smile.gif Самое простое и самое дешевое smile.gif

biggrin.gif ну вот зачем разводить ненужную полемику?
=GM=:"...принимать какую-нибудь круглосуточную радиостанцию в диапазоне ДВ или СВ .." -возможно не лучшая альтернатива. А возни с наладкой,настройкой..и тестированием вообще вагон.


Цитата(muravei @ Oct 15 2007, 14:28) *
А вообще, есть станции , вещающие частоту специально для привязки времени.

Токо у нас они не распространены..:-(
http://tf.nist.gov/stations/wwvbtimecode.htm


--------------------
Если задачу можно решить, то не надо тревожиться. А если нельзя решить, то тревожиться бесполезно.
Go to the top of the page
 
+Quote Post
DS
сообщение Oct 15 2007, 11:58
Сообщение #14


Гуру
******

Группа: СуперМодераторы
Сообщений: 3 096
Регистрация: 16-01-06
Из: Москва
Пользователь №: 13 250



Цитата(Anjey_N @ Oct 15 2007, 11:28) *
С кофе в постель было бы неплохо!
Можно поставить RTC, но у Атину2313 нет аппаратного I2C. Писать программный интерфейс неохота.


Чтобы работать с одной микросхемой часов пишется за 2 часа времени без какого-либо напряга, без полных знаний протокола, только по datasheet микросхемы часов. Тем более зачатки в 2313 есть. Не вижу проблемы - Вы, видимо, просто наслушались про сложности i2c. В данном случае сложностей никаких нет.


--------------------
Не бойтесь тюрьмы, не бойтесь сумы, не бойтесь мора и глада, а бойтесь единственно только того, кто скажет - "Я знаю как надо". А. Галич.
Go to the top of the page
 
+Quote Post
D H
сообщение Oct 15 2007, 14:00
Сообщение #15


Участник
*

Группа: Участник
Сообщений: 62
Регистрация: 1-11-06
Пользователь №: 21 847



Цитата(DS @ Oct 15 2007, 15:58) *
Чтобы работать с одной микросхемой часов пишется за 2 часа времени без какого-либо напряга, без полных знаний протокола, только по datasheet микросхемы часов. Тем более зачатки в 2313 есть. Не вижу проблемы - Вы, видимо, просто наслушались про сложности i2c. В данном случае сложностей никаких нет.


Абсолютно согласен. Если ломает самому писать или искать готовую библиотеку, то в CodeVision есть готовая софтовая библиотка i2c.
Go to the top of the page
 
+Quote Post

4 страниц V   1 2 3 > » 
Reply to this topicStart new topic
2 чел. читают эту тему (гостей: 2,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 18th July 2025 - 17:35
Рейтинг@Mail.ru


Страница сгенерированна за 0.01472 секунд с 7
ELECTRONIX ©2004-2016